I tried the evaluation version of Decuma Alphabet . I liked it so much that I bought the full version from Handango. I installed the full program but now the trial has expired I get a message: "Your evaluation period has expired." It wont allow any more text input.
At no time during installation am I askd for the activation/registration key.
I uninstalled the program and reinstalled the paid-for version but I still get the message and cannot use the program!
Any ideas how to get the program activated?

you go to control panel>text input>Decuma Alphabet and you go to the options there and click register somewhere there....
